Output fbbdc831ad826b27dac21ed17f8f0ff7849024fac8a2ca241b46082e696f37ea:23

value
12600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d9224826bedfbcec9afc75aaf29ae401be661a18 OP_EQUALVERIFY OP_CHECKSIG
address
1Lo6ha8otU5JpP57WH5pz7tS95562sc65X
transaction
fbbdc831ad826b27dac21ed17f8f0ff7849024fac8a2ca241b46082e696f37ea
spent
true